Bursting out of what was becoming the Seattle scene Pearl Jam achieved mainstream success with its debut album, anachronistically named Ten. The popularity of the album was slow coming, but has shown a staying power over the decades. Often identified with the grunge movement, and considered highly influential, Pearl Jam nevertheless defies labels. Their strong melodies and melancholy, open lyrics evoke not only grunge, but metal, alternative rock, and straightforward hard rock.
